Central Mall.

Next to the colorful ice cream truck, there were one big and two small ones standing.

Lilly laid on the transparent glass cabinet, holding back her saliva, “Auntie, I want a yogurt ball, a strawberry ball, and a mango ball!”

The ice cream lady scooped out scoops of ice cream, according to the taste she ordered. Each scoop was scooped round and big. The ice cream cup was filled with three ice cream balls of different colors.

When Lilly took it, she took a bite first, then handed it out to Hannah.

Hannah was staring at the ice cream in the ice cream truck with bright eyes, waved his hands and said, “No, no, I want to choose by myself!”

Lilly held up the ice cream again, “Instructor MacNeil, hey!”

Blake was amused, bent down and took a small bite, and tapped her nose with his finger, “Call me daddy.”

Lilly, “Daddy!”

Blake could not help but beamed, the more he looked at his little girl, the more he liked her.

Pablo floated by the side, wondering, “What’s so delicious about ice cream?”

Lilly squinted at him, “Master, have you ever had one? The ice cream is super delicious.”

Pablo curled his lips and said, “What’s delicious, isn’t it just ice slag.”

Not envious at all.

While thinking, he quickly glanced at the ice cream in Lilly’s hand.

After Blake paid the money, he still leaned against the flower bed, but this time it was one big and two small ones.

A young lady turned her head while walking, only to hear the door slammed against the door again.

Hannah, “Hahaha! Young lady must have been looking at my ice cream, she was hungry!”

Lilly, “I think she might be looking at my father.”

Blake, “Heh… she’s looking at you.”

The three foodies chit-chatted as they enjoyed the ice creams.

Seeing them eating with gusto, Pablo turned around speechlessly, sat cross-legged on the edge of the flower bed, and resigned himself to flipping through the books.

What was so delicious about ice cream, he’d better read the brochure!

In the past few days, he almost dug out the booklet, but he still could not find Jean’s whereabouts.
